<p>The updated Prep Hoops Illinois 2026 Rankings were released on Monday. All this week we will be breaking them down including here in <strong>2026 Rankings: Post New Additions</strong>!</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2734383' first='Jacobi' last='Walls'] (Hyde Park)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>This 6'6” broad shouldered post flashed during the first half of the season to us as a post defender.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2323326' first='Jordan' last='Shaw'] (De La Salle)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Shaw has been a solid post for the Meteors when we have seen him this season as a rebounder and post scorer.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2387603' first='Leslie' last='Pobee'] (Plainfield East)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Undersized 6'4” four man that finishes well through contact and carves out room inside to do work on dunks and hook shots.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2482184' first='Adam' last='Bauer'] (Cary Grove)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>This 6'6” post from Cary Grove ran the floor well and was tough finishing around the basket on put backs and playing through defenders in the paint.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2734418' first='Evan' last='Brewer'] (Granite City)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Brewer was a perfect 9-9 from the field when we saw him play in the Collinsville Tournament including hitting a trio of threes.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2323330' first='John' last='Spellers'] (Whitney Young)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Spellers has emerged as one of the primary big men for the Dolphins this year with his broad shoulders and toughness inside.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p><strong>[player_tooltip player_id='2424631' first='Jeremy' last='McCullum'] (Bolingbrook)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>High energy role player for Bolingbrook that is active on the glass, gets loose balls, run the floor, and finishes out of the dunker spot.</p>
